A Skin Specialist in Singapore Can Help with Common Skin Problems
Skin specialists in Singapore can offer a wide range of services, from treating children with skin problems to performing cosmetic treatments. They deal with the following issues most often:
- Acne: Acne doesn’t just happen to teens; it can also affect adults and cause a lot of mental pain and scarring. If you want to get rid of acne, a skin expert can help you with different kinds of treatments, like chemical peels and laser therapy, topical creams, and oral medications.
- Eczema (Atopic Dermatitis): Skin that is red, itchy, and swollen with eczema can be very painful. A skin specialist in Singapore can help you determine the cause of your symptoms, prescribe medication to alleviate them, and offer guidance on long-term skin care to prevent flare-ups.
- Psoriasis: This chronic autoimmune disease causes thick, scaly patches of skin. There is no cure, but a skin specialist in Singapore can create a treatment plan that includes topical treatments, phototherapy, or systemic medications to relieve symptoms and improve the skin’s appearance.
- Fungal Infections: Fungal infections, such as athlete’s foot and ringworm, can persist for an extended period and cause significant discomfort. A skin specialist in Singapore can accurately identify the type of infection and prescribe the proper antifungal medication to treat it.
- Hair and Nail Disorders: A skin expert can also help with hair loss, brittle nails, and nail infections by identifying the root causes and recommending the most effective treatments.
- Pigmentation Disorders: Melasma, sunspots, and post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ation are all conditions that can change the tone and consistency of your skin. If you experience these problems, a skin expert can help with treatments such as laser therapies and topical lightening agents.
- Allergic Skin Responses: Contact dermatitis and other allergic reactions to substances such as plants, jewelry, or cosmetics can be very painful. A skin specialist in Singapore can help you identify the allergen and suggest ways to avoid it and manage your symptoms.
- Skin Cancers: Skin cancers, including melanoma, basal cell carcinoma, and squamous cell carcinoma, are severe conditions that require early detection and specialized treatment. Skin checks by a skin specialist in Singapore should be done regularly to find suspicious sores.
- Anti-Aging and Cosmetic Concerns: Many people in Singapore consult a skin expert for cosmetic improvements, such as Botox, dermal fillers, and various laser treatments to address wrinkles, fine lines, sagging skin, and uneven skin tone.

Besides Treatment: Talk to Your Skin Specialist in Singapore about Skin Health and Prevention
A dermatologist in Singapore can not only help you treat skin problems but also maintain your skin’s health over time and prevent future issues. They can advise on:
- Effective Skincare Routines: A skin expert can help you find the right cleansers, moisturizers, sunscreens, and other products tailored to your skin type and specific concerns.
- Sun Protection Strategies: Since Singapore is located in a tropical environment, it is crucial to protect yourself from the sun in all ways. A skin specialist in Singapore can provide you with personalized advice on how to effectively wear sunscreen and clothing that will protect you, as well as strategies to stay out of the sun to make you less likely to get skin cancer. And harm from the sun.
- Skin Cancer Can Be Found Early: Regular self-exams and yearly skin checks by a professional are crucial ways to detect skin cancer early, when it is most easily treated. This is especially true if you have risk factors. You can learn how to do self-exams and what to look for from a skin expert.
